With its beautiful interior and many art treasures, a visit to St Rombouts Cathedral can sometimes be a bit overwhelming. That's why we would like to introduce you to our guide: Lucas Faydherbe! This famous Mechelen sculptor and architect, pupil of the great Pieter Paul Rubens, lived from 1617 to 1697. Together with his contemporaries, he left an indelible mark on the cathedral's appearance.
Faydherbe is therefore the ideal guide to explore with you thirteen highlights in the nave of the church. He provides his explanations in a stylish visitor's guidebook with beautiful photographic material, supplemented by fun facts from the past and present.
